The Partition Agreement format in Middlesex facilitates the voluntary division of real property among co-owners, providing a clear outline of each owner's rights and responsibilities. The document begins with the identification of all co-owners and a description of the property in question. It ensures that the co-owners acknowledge their sole ownership and outlines procedures for equitable division of the property into specific tracts for each person involved. As part of the agreement, co-owners agree to execute quitclaim deeds to formalize the transfer of their respective tracts, which helps eliminate future disputes regarding rights and claims on the property.
